A couple of questions primarily for George Ferzoco: does the FEAST 
posting take new saints into account?  If so, what is the FEAST day 
of Edward Burdon, martyred at York in 1587/8 and beatified in 1987?

Now to throw the matter open to all m-r readers.  Does anyone know 
whether - or where to find whether - the said Burdon (possibly alias 
Burden, Borden or Bowden) can be identified with the Durham man of 
that name who was at Oxford in the 1560s (matriculated at Corpus 
Christi College 1558, BA 1561, MA 1566).
